In the English Civil War, supporters of Parliament were known as what?

ACavaliers
BRoundheads
CRoyalists
DTories

Answer & explanation

The correct answer is Roundheads.

Supporters of Parliament were known as the Roundheads, while those who supported the king were called the Cavaliers.
